What Is IPL Pigmentation Removal?

IPL (Intense Pulsed Light) uses broad-spectrum light to target excess melanin in the skin. When the light pulses hit areas of pigmentation, they break up the pigment, allowing your body to naturally eliminate it over time.

It’s effective on:

  • Sun spots

  • Age spots

  • Freckles

  • Uneven skin tone

  • General sun damage

Real Client Results

We’ve seen incredible transformations in clients struggling with sun damage and stubborn pigmentation. After just a few IPL sessions, their skin looks brighter, more even, and more youthful.

Typical results after 1–3 sessions:

  • Pigment darkens slightly in the first 48 hours (this is good — it’s lifting!)

  • Spots begin to flake or fade after 5–10 days

  • Overall brightness improves noticeably

  • Pores look smaller and skin texture smooths out

Best results after 4–6 sessions:

  • Significant reduction in visible pigment

  • Even, glowing skin tone

  • Long-lasting results with proper skincare & SPF

What to Expect at Your Appointment

  1. Consultation: We assess your skin, pigmentation type, and suitability for IPL.

  2. Treatment: Protective eyewear is applied and gentle light pulses target the pigment.

  3. Post-Treatment: Skin may feel warm or flushed — this is normal.

  4. Aftercare: SPF daily and avoiding sun exposure are key for best results.
